What Is ChatGPT Gov and What Makes It Special?

On January 28, 2025, OpenAI unveiled ChatGPT Gov, a version of their AI chatbot designed specifically to meet the needs of U.S. federal, state, and local government agencies. Unlike generic consumer options, this model is engineered to comply with government regulations, address compliance standards, and operate within a secure environment.
Key features include:
  • Deployment on Microsoft Azure Cloud: Agencies can host ChatGPT Gov within Microsoft Azure's commercial cloud environment, benefiting from the stability, security, and scalability associated with enterprise-grade solutions.
  • ChatGPT Enterprise Features: Following in the footsteps of ChatGPT Enterprise, it empowers users with functionality like saving and sharing conversations, interpreting and summarizing text or images, analyzing files, working with code, and processing mathematics.
  • Secure Handling of Sensitive Data: ChatGPT Gov prioritizes the secure processing and storage of non-public government data, aligning with federal security and compliance requirements.
It’s more than another tool in the governmental tech toolbox; it represents a conscious effort to modernize governmental operations while ensuring that AI adoption adheres to safety, privacy, and transparency standards.

Why This Launch Matters for the U.S. Government

Governments around the globe grapple with using AI responsibly. For the United States, ChatGPT Gov could become a critical instrument in achieving the following objectives:
  • Boosting Productivity: Government agencies often deal with large, intricate datasets. ChatGPT could render this data manageable by summarizing, analyzing, and offering actionable insights.
  • Addressing Compliance Challenges: Historically, AI struggle with compliance concerns. OpenAI’s tailored solution paves the way for the U.S. government to integrate AI securely without compromising on sensitive information.
  • Global Leadership in Technology: With increasing competition from nations like China and their AI advancements (ahem… looking at you, “DeepSeek”), the U.S. needs robust AI tools to retain its technological leadership.
Kevin Weil, OpenAI’s Chief Product Officer, highlighted that ChatGPT Gov aligns with the “national interest and public good”, ensuring AI development and deployment aligns with democratic principles.

The Global AI Race: DeepSeek vs. ChatGPT

While ChatGPT Gov aims to solidify the United States’ AI capabilities, the shadow of competition looms large. China's DeepSeek recently sparked global conversations by dethroning ChatGPT as the most downloaded AI app on Apple’s App Store. Its rise, however, came with controversies, such as restricting sensitive queries and potential misuse for suppressing unwanted narratives.
OpenAI’s announcement comes on the heels of mounting pressure. The comparison between ChatGPT and DeepSeek isn’t just about which chatbot can generate better outputs but also about what they represent: an ideological war on how AI should grow and who gets to control it. While DeepSeek offers rapid advancements in capabilities (albeit with restricted transparency), OpenAI seems to prioritize ethical guardrails and usability for diverse sectors like government.

How Does ChatGPT Gov Work?

So, how does deploying ChatGPT Gov differ from using your everyday version of ChatGPT? Let’s break it down:
  • Integration with Microsoft Azure: The service allows for seamless integration into government cloud ecosystems. Imagine an agency being able to ask ChatGPT about regulations or summarize a 500-page internal memo securely. The availability within Azure ensures that all data processed meets government-grade security standards.
  • Role-Specific AI Use Cases: By tailoring the AI to agency-specific workflows, it can complete tasks like legal document summarization, financial forecasting, or even personnel management with AI-driven insights.
  • Auditability and Compliance: Compliance has always been the Achilles’ heel of AI in critical sectors. With prebuilt tools for monitoring and auditing, ChatGPT Gov addresses concerns around privacy, bias, and accountability.
  • Human-AI Collaboration: Unlike replacing human oversight, ChatGPT Gov emphasizes acting as a collaborative resource. This is particularly important for government applications where decisions carry national security implications.

What Happens Next?

The early signs indicate strong adoption, with over 90,000 government users already experimenting with ChatGPT solutions across various agencies even before this tailored release. According to Felipe Millon, leader of OpenAI’s Go to Market program, government feedback has been instrumental in pushing for this modified version.
